TECHNICAL FIELD

[0001] Embodiments of the present application relate to the technical field of display, and in particular, to a display panel and a display device. BACKGROUND

[0002] With the development and progress of display technologies such as flexible display panels, the requirements for the preparation efficiency and quality of display panels and display devices are also increasing. The substrate of a flexible display panel is usually formed of a flexible material, and a glass substrate formed of a rigid material provides support for the flexible substrate to improve the yield of subsequent film layer preparation. In the preparation process of a traditional display panel, a plurality of screen functional layers are usually formed on the surface of a composite substrate formed of a large rigid substrate and a flexible substrate in a region-by-region manner to obtain a middle plate, and then the middle plate is cut to obtain a plurality of individual display panels. To avoid damage to the display panel caused by the cutting machine, a protective layer is usually arranged on the surface of the encapsulation layer of the display panel, and the protective layer is peeled off after cutting is completed.

[0003] For a display panel with an opening requirement, the opening and cutting are usually performed synchronously, which increases the bonding force between the protective layer around the opening and the display panel, increases the film tearing stress generated during peeling, and further damages the display panel around the opening, thereby affecting the yield of the display panel. [0052] It should be noted that in the preparation process of the conventional display panel, the middle plate including a plurality of screen functional layers is usually flipped on the cutting machine, so that the side of the screen functional layer away from the substrate faces the machine. In the process of cutting and hole opening, the substrate, the screen functional layer and the protective layer in the edge and the hole opening area are simultaneously removed. Therefore, in the process of hole opening, the stress around the hole is concentrated, and the extrusion generated during hole opening can further enhance the adhesion of the protective layer and the screen functional layer around the hole.

[0053] However, in the process of peeling off the protective layer, due to the increased bonding force between the protective layer around the hole and the screen functional layer, the peeling stress generated during peeling also needs to be increased. In addition, in the process of peeling off the protective layer, the stress direction and stress size around the hole will change with the gradual peeling of the protective layer, further causing uneven stress of the screen functional layer around the hole, thereby increasing the risk of damage to the screen functional layer around the hole, affecting the yield of the display panel.

[0054] For display panels with hole opening requirements, hole opening and cutting are usually performed synchronously, thereby increasing the bonding force between the protective layer around the hole and the display panel, increasing the film tearing stress generated during peeling, and further causing the display panel around the hole to be damaged, affecting the yield of the display panel.

[0055] As shown in Figure 1 The first aspect of the embodiments of the present application provides a display panel, the display panel comprising a display area and a hole area, the display area surrounding the hole area, the display panel comprising: a substrate 100, a screen functional layer 200 and a protective layer 300. Wherein the screen functional layer 200 is located on one side of the substrate 100, and the screen functional layer 200 is provided with a first through hole H1, and the first through hole H1 is located in the display area; the protective layer 300 is located on the side of the screen functional layer 200 away from the substrate 100, and the protective layer 300 is provided with a second through hole H2, and the first through hole H1 and the second through hole H2 are in communication, and the surface of the protective layer 300 away from the substrate 100 is provided with at least one groove G; wherein the groove G is in communication with the second through hole H2, and the depth dimension of the groove G is less than the thickness dimension of the protective layer 300.

[0056] Exemplarily, the groove G can also be arranged on the surface of the protective layer 300 close to the substrate 100. However, it should be noted that arranging the groove G on the surface of the protective layer 300 close to the substrate 100 will result in a decrease in the bonding area of the protective layer 300 and the screen functional layer 200, thereby resulting in insufficient bonding force between the protective layer 300 and the screen functional layer 200, increasing the risk of the protective layer 300 separating during the display panel flipping process, affecting the reliability and safety of the display panel preparation. In addition, arranging the groove G on the surface of the protective layer 300 close to the substrate 100 will also result in a decrease in the stability of the display panel during cutting, thereby reducing the accuracy of the display panel hole opening, affecting the yield of the display panel.

[0057] The display panel provided by the embodiment of the present application can protect the surface of the display panel in the process of cutting and opening of the display panel by arranging the protective layer 300 on the side of the screen functional layer 200 away from the substrate 100, so as to avoid scratching of the display panel. Meanwhile, the second through hole H2 of the protective layer 300 is in communication with the first through hole H1 of the screen functional layer 200, and the groove G is arranged on the side of the protective layer 300 away from the screen functional layer 200, so that the groove G is in communication with the second through hole H2. The thickness of the protective layer 300 around the second through hole H2 can be reduced by arranging the groove G, and then the bonding force between the protective layer 300 around the second through hole H2 and the screen functional layer 200 around the first through hole H1 can be reduced. Further, the stress generated by the peeling of the protective layer 300 on the screen functional layer 200 around the first through hole H1 can be reduced in the process of peeling the protective layer 300, so as to avoid damage to the screen functional layer 200 around the first through hole H1 caused by the peeling of the protective layer 300, further improve the surface integrity of the display panel, and improve the yield of the display panel.

[0074] In some possible implementation manners, the groove G includes two connected connection sections, and the two connection sections in the same groove G have shapes of arcs with opposite opening directions in the orthogonal projection towards the base 100; wherein the arc radius of the connection section is positively correlated with the hole diameter of the second through hole H2.

[0075] It should be noted that, in the case that the hole diameter of the second through hole H2 is large, the edge circumference of the second through hole H2 is long, so that the peeling time of the protective layer 300 at the edge of the second through hole H2 is prolonged in the peeling process of the protective layer 300, and further the peeling stress of the protective layer 300 at the edge of the second through hole H2 is accumulated, thereby causing the peeling risk of the screen functional layer 200 to be increased. By increasing the arc radius of the connection section, the length of the connection section in the radial direction of the second through hole H2 can be increased, and further the length of the groove G can be increased, so that the stress acting on the edge of the second through hole H2 can be sufficiently dispersed by the groove G, and the damage risk of the screen functional layer 200 around the first through hole H1 caused by the peeling of the protective layer 300 can be reduced.

[0076] The display panel provided by the embodiment of the present application can facilitate setting the shape of the groove G according to the hole diameter of the second through hole H2 by setting the arc radius of the connection section to be positively correlated with the hole diameter of the second through hole H2. For the second through hole H2 with a large hole diameter, the arc radius of the connection section can be increased accordingly, the length of the groove G can be increased by extension, the stress acting on the edge of the second through hole H2 can be sufficiently dispersed, the damage risk of the screen functional layer 200 around the first through hole H1 caused by the peeling of the protective layer 300 can be reduced, the surface integrity of the display panel can be improved, and the yield of the display panel can be improved. For the second through hole H2 with a small hole diameter, the arc radius of the connection section can be reduced accordingly, the distance between the edge of the groove G and the edge of the protective layer 300 can be increased, the fracture risk of the protective layer 300 can be reduced, the peeling difficulty of the protective layer 300 can be reduced, the peeling efficiency of the protective layer 300 can be improved, and further the preparation efficiency and the preparation quality of the display panel can be improved.

[0079] As shown in FIG. 1, Figure 7As shown, in some feasible embodiments, the depth dimension of the groove G is negatively correlated with the extension length of the groove G from the second through hole H2 in the extension direction of the groove G.

[0080] It should be noted that, in the extension direction of the groove G, the depth of the groove G near the second through hole H2 is greater than the depth of the groove G away from the second through hole H2. During the hole-opening process, the protective layer 300 near the second through hole H2 experiences greater stress. The compression during hole opening results in a greater bonding strength between the protective layer 300 near the second through hole H2 and the screen functional layer 200 than between the protective layer 300 away from the second through hole H2 and the screen functional layer 200. By increasing the depth of the groove G, the thickness of the protective layer 300 on the surface of the screen functional layer 200 can be reduced, thereby reducing the bonding force between the protective layer 300 and the screen functional layer 200 and reducing the stress required for peeling.

[0081] The display panel provided in this application embodiment sets the depth of the groove G to be negatively correlated with the extension length of the groove G from the second through hole H2. This facilitates setting the depth of the groove G according to the extension length of the groove G. For the end of the groove G that is closer to the second through hole H2, the depth of the groove G can be increased, and the thickness of the protective layer 300 at the corresponding position can be reduced. This reduces the bonding force between the screen functional layer 200 and the protective layer 300 at that position, reduces the stress required for peeling, reduces the peeling difficulty, and also reduces the tensile force generated during peeling, reducing the risk of the protective layer 300 damaging the surface integrity of the local screen functional layer 200. At the same time, for the end of the groove G that is farther from the second through hole H2, the depth of the groove G can be reduced to improve the stability during the cutting process. This avoids the groove G being too deep, which would result in insufficient support capacity of the protective layer 300 around the groove G, causing the protective layer 300 to wobble about the groove G and affecting the accuracy of the opening. This improves the manufacturing quality and yield of the display panel.

[0084] In some possible embodiments, the ratio of the depth size of the groove G to the thickness size of the protective layer 300 is in the range of 40% to 60%.

[0085] It should be noted that if the ratio of the depth size of the groove G to the thickness size of the protective layer 300 is too large, the thickness of the protective layer 300 at the bottom of the groove G will be small, and the stress on the protective layer 300 at the bottom of the groove G during the peeling process will be large, thereby further increasing the risk of fracture of the protective layer 300 during the peeling process. If the ratio of the depth size of the groove G to the thickness size of the protective layer 300 is too small, the thickness of the protective layer 300 at the bottom of the groove G will be large, which limits the effect of the groove G on reducing the bonding force between the protective layer 300 and the screen functional layer 200, and further increases the bonding force between the protective layer 300 and the screen functional layer 200 during the peeling process of the protective layer 300, thereby increasing the damage risk of the screen functional layer 200.
